OBJECTIVE: The purpose of this study is to examine the effects of zonisamide on ethanol self-administration and subjective effects in risky drinkers using a human laboratory paradigm. METHOD: We conducted a double-blind, placebo-controlled study of the effects of zonisamide 100 mg on ethanol self-administration and urge to drink in risky drinkers (N = 10) ( [1] ). RESULT: During the second hour of a 2-hour self-administration session ethanol consumption was 50% lower in the zonisamide group as compared to the placebo group. Urge to drink was also significantly lower under the zonisamide condition. CONCLUSION: These results indicate that a single dose of zonisamide reduces urge to drink and the quantity of ethanol self-administered by risky drinkers during their second hour of access to alcohol. SCIENTIFIC SIGNIFICANCE: Zonisamide may help individuals drinking at risky levels reduce their intake of alcohol.
